What is an LLC?

Find the right LLC attorney in Norwalk, CA

The Limited Liability Company, or LLC, is a legal form of business organization that offers the advantages of several other traditional structures. Like a sole proprietorship or partnership, an LLC is not taxed as its own entity. However, it still has the advantage of limited liability, the same as a corporation. LLC's, like corporations, can also have as many shareholders, or members, as desired. The LLC, however, is dissolved if one of those members files for bankruptcy or dies. Various forms of limited liability companies have been around for hundreds years, but the modern LLC, like the legislature enacted in California, became more popular in the past several decades.

Can My Business Be Formed as an LLC?

A business in California can be organized using the form that it chooses. If the founders want to organize as an LLC, all that is required is filing the appropriate form with the Secretary of State. However, fees are often required to form a LLC. The actions of LLC's as well as the costs for operating them are determined by California law. In deciding whether you should organize as an LLC, you should consider carefully the applicable laws. Life in Norwalk

Norwalk is a suburb located in Los Angeles County, California. It boasts a population of over 105,000 people and is the California's 58th most populated city. The economy of Norwalk, California is driven largely by retail and entertainment business. Its location close to Los Angeles makes it a popular place for living and recreation.

The city of Norwalk emphasizes the development of arts and culture. For example, Norwalk operates an "Art in Public Places Program", which places internationally- recognized high-caliber sculptures on display throughout the city. The Program is intended to raise awareness of art in Norwalk while at the same time beautifying the city. Due to its artistic appeal, many films and television shows were filmed in Norwalk, such as the Karate Kid, CHiPs, and Monk.

Norwalk is an important city for lawyers as it is home to the Los Angeles County Registrar and Recorder. The Registrar's office has jurisdiction over matters like voter registration and marriage license issuance. It is also responsible for recording legal documentation of real property as well as birth, death, and marriage records. The office services over 2,000 customers per day and maintains over 2 million personal and real property documents.
